Dana Welles Delany was born on March 13, 1956, in New York City and raised in Stamford, Connecticut. Dana knew early in life that she wanted to be an actress. Trivia

Her grandfather invented the Delany valve, a flushing device still use in todays toilets.

1991: Chosen by People magazine as one of the 50 Most Beautiful People in the World.

Attended and graduated from Wesleyan University.

She was the voice of two superheroes girlfriends: Andrea Beaumount, girlfriend of Bruce Wayne, in Batman: Mask of the Phantasm ; and Lois Lane in "Superman" .

Although she is from New York City and is a stage-trained actress, she admitted in an interview that she prefers film and television work to stage work.

Attended Phillips Academy Andover for her senior year of high school.

Attended Stamford, Connecticut, public schools until her senior year in high school.

3/18/81: Her father, who was her biggest fan, died from pancreatic cancer.

Has an older brother, Sean Delany, and a younger sister, Corey Delany.

When she moved to New York City in the 1970s, she worked as a cocktail waitress while waiting for her big break.

Friend of Arleen Sorkin Bob Saget , Garry Shandling and Regina Hall.

Her first and last names are quoted in the final rhyme to the "Animaniacs" theme song.

Original choice for the role of "Bree" on "Desperate Housewives" . Role went to her friend, Marcia Cross. They both appeared on "Cheers" , but on different episodes.

Favorite TV shows are "Mad Men" and "30 Rock" .

Her mother is related to Abraham Lincoln s Secretary of the Navy, Gideon Welles.

Turned down the role of "Carrie Bradshaw" on "Sex and the City" . The part went to Sarah Jessica Parker.

Since the mid 1990s, Dana has been serving on the board of Scleroderma Research Foundation, and is involved in the campaign to find a cure.

One of People magazines Most Beautiful People in the World 2011.

Irish-American.

She speaks Gaeilge (Traditional language of Ireland).

She has played the same character (Lois Lane) in three different series: "Superman" , "Justice League" and "The Batman" .

Is a supporter of Planned Parenthood and LGBT rights.

Starred in "Desperate Housewives" (2004-2012), alongside Teri Hatcher , with whom she shares the role of "Lois Lane". Both women also played the love interest of James Denton , who played the role of Lois Lanes love interest, Clark Kent/Superman in All-Star Superman .

Auditioned to play "Jade Butterfield" in Endless Love , and got the part. However, director Franco Zeffirelli turned her down because she wasnt a major movie star at the time, so Brooke Shields was cast instead.

She has never married nor had children.
